Jeff Ford, 2023 Provost’s Award for Teaching Excellence Winner

Jeff Ford (Mathematics, Computer Science, and Statistics) was selected as the 2023 recipient of the Provost’s Award for Teaching Excellence. Presented each year at the final faculty meeting, this award recognizes a Gustavus non-tenure-track faculty member for significant contributions to teaching and learning.
